It is time to begin our Louise Nevelson project.  We must have these items to create the artwork.  Louise Nevelson was an artist who took items that may appear like trash to some people and created beautiful sculptures with them.  Your mission is to find pieces of plastics, woods, and metals that can be painted.  For example: bolts, screws, wine corks, puzzle pieces, buttons, small wooden objects, pasta, trinkets from a dollar store or garage sale are always popular.  Whatever you can find that meets these needs will be greatly appreciated to begin our projects.
